Owning your perfect home is a rewarding goal for most people. But the standard mortgage process can sometimes be challenging. That's where alternative mortgages come in. A private mortgage is a financing that is provided by a individual lender, rather than a traditional bank or financial institution. This can offer several advantages for borrowers who may not qualify for a typical mortgage.

The primary pro of a private mortgage is that lenders are often more accommodating with their terms. They may be willing to consider borrowers who have less credit history, lower credit scores, or unusual employment situations. Moreover, private lenders may be faster to approve loan applications, which can reduce time and hassle.

Bridge the Gap: Private Mortgage Solutions for Challenging Credit

For individuals experiencing credit challenges, acquiring a traditional mortgage can seem like an insurmountable obstacle. Fortunately, private mortgage solutions provide alternative path to homeownership. These programs are designed to consider borrowers with less-than-perfect credit scores by offering more relaxed lending criteria. With a private mortgage, you may be able to access financing even if you have past defaults.

Private lenders often focus on your earnings and current economic situation rather than solely relying on your credit history. This can unlock doors to homeownership for those who have faced difficulties in the past.

  • Consider different private mortgage lenders to find one that best aligns with your circumstances.
  • Boost your credit score whenever possible, as it can still influence the terms of your loan.
  • Become transparent about your financial history with the lender to build trust and increase your chances of approval.
